关于弹性搜索的非常基本的问题,文档没有很清楚地回答(因为他们似乎进入了很多高级的细节,但错过了基本的!
示例:范围查询
http://www.elasticsearch.org/guide/reference/query-dsl/range-query.html
不知道如何PERFORM的范围,是通过搜索端点吗?
如果是,那么如何通过querystring来做呢?我的意思是,我想做一个GET,而不是一个POST(因为它是一个查询,而不是插入/修改).但是,GET请求的记录不能像在Range示例中那样使用JSON:
http://www.elasticsearch.org/guide/reference/api/search/uri-request.html
我失踪了什么
谢谢
解决方法
使用
Lucene query syntax:
curl -X GET 'http://localhost:9200/my_index/_search?q=my_field:[0+TO+25]&pretty'